Plastic converters operating within these industrial zones face unique technical challenges: operating lines at high throughput while maintaining structural integrity under intense UV exposure, ambient temperatures frequently exceeding 40°C, and varying local resin grades. Consequently, securing high-performance color masterbatch and calcium carbonate (CaCO3) filler masterbatch with consistent melt indices and thermal resistance up to 260°C is critical to maintaining operational margins and batch uniformity.
By integrating high-dispersion virgin-PE carried masterbatches, Egyptian manufacturers can decrease raw polymer consumption, eliminate die build-up on blown film lines, and reduce machine downtime caused by un-dispersed pigment agglomerates.

Our formulations utilize ultra-pure linear low-density polyethylene (LLDPE) and polypropylene (PP) carriers matched precisely to the melt flow index (MFI) of local Egyptian resin grades like Sinopec, SABIC, or Borouge polymers, ensuring zero phase separation.
Utilizing high-torque, twin-screw co-rotating extrusion lines with triple degassing zones, raw organic and inorganic pigments are shear-dispersed down to sub-micron particle sizes (< 2.5 µm), preventing screen pack clogging during high-speed blown film operations.
Formulated with Hindered Amine Light Stabilizers (HALS) and UV-absorbing organic additives specifically suited for the severe solar radiation environment of Egypt, preventing photo-oxidative degradation and premature yellowing.

Egyptian agricultural operations rely on multi-layer greenhouse films and drip irrigation systems. Our high-concentration PE White & Black Masterbatches incorporate thermal stabilizers and anti-fogging additives that extend film lifespan to over 36 months under intense sunshine while maintaining high tensile strength and puncture resistance.
National water distribution and gas infrastructure projects in Egypt require PE100 black pipe extrusion compound standards. Our carbon black masterbatches use high-structure P-type carbon black with fine particle size (< 20nm), ensuring flawless UV protection, smooth pipe inner surfaces, and long-term hydrostatic strength (MRS 10.0 MPa compliance).
Food packaging manufacturers in 10th of Ramadan City require strict FDA-compliant color concentrates. Our non-toxic, anti-migration color masterbatches deliver opaque, brilliant aesthetics for shopping bags, bread bags, laminate films, and caps/closures without taste or odor contamination.
For heavy-duty crates, pallets, and household wares manufactured in 6th of October City, our specialty functional masterbatches ensure structural rigidity, anti-static performance, and resistance to environmental stress cracking (ESCR).
To provide complete transparency for procurement teams evaluating China-to-Egypt imports, all product batches undergo strict laboratory testing against standardized metrics prior to container loading at Shanghai or Ningbo ports.
| Test Parameter | Standard Testing Method | Typical Specification Target | Industrial Relevance for Converter |
|---|---|---|---|
| Carrier Base Polymer | ASTM D1238 / ISO 1133 | PE, PP, or Universal Resin | Ensures perfect melt-blending with base substrate resin. |
| Pigment Content (%) | ASTM D5630 / ISO 3451 | 20% - 75% Load (Product Specific) | Determines tinting strength and let-down ratio economy. |
| Heat Resistance (°C) | EN 12877-2 | 220°C - 300°C (260°C Standard) | Prevents color shifting or chemical breakdown in extruders. |
| Light Fastness (Blue Wool Scale) | ISO 105-B02 | Grade 7 to Grade 8 | Guarantees resistance against severe African solar fading. |
| Filter Pressure Value (FPV) | EN 13900-5 | < 1.0 bar/g pigment | Confirms zero screen-pack clogging on fine blown film lines. |
| Moisture Content (%) | ASTM D6980 | < 0.15% max | Prevents bubble tears, surface lensing, and voids in films. |

For standard packaging and carrier bag films, the recommended Let-Down Ratio (LDR) ranges between 1% to 4% by weight, depending on the pigment concentration and desired film opacity. For high-opacity white masterbatch containing 70% Rutile TiO2, an LDR of 2% is typically sufficient to achieve complete hiding power even at film thicknesses below 25 microns.
Summer operating conditions in regions like Sadat City or Upper Egypt can cause premature soft-pellet agglomeration in standard masterbatches. Our formulations incorporate high-melting-point synthetic waxes and heat stabilizers rated up to 260°C–300°C. This ensures pellets remain free-flowing in hopper systems without melting or bridging prior to entering the extruder barrel.
